| A | B |
| apprentice | a person who learns a skill as an assistant |
| Great Awakening | movement that revived religious feelings |
| Enlightenment | movement that stresses reason and science |
| Magna Carta | British document giving rights to nobles and citizens |
| parliament | English lawmaking body of government |
| Glorious Revolution | replaced King James with William and Mary |
| salutary neglect | hands off policy of British towards the colonies |
| Albany Plan of Union | First attempt to unite the colonies |
| Treaty of Paris | Agreement ending the Seven Years War |
| Proclamation of 1763 | No British settlements west of Appalacians |
